The Bureau of the Committee met with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µ Secretary-General Ant¨®nio Guterres to express concern at the worsening situation in the Occupied Palestinian Territory (OPT), including East Jerusalem. The Chair of the Committee, Ambassador Cheikh Niang (Senegal) encouraged the Secretary-General to visit the OPT as soon as possible to learn first-hand about the situation on the ground and provide much needed hope to the Palestinian population under occupation and attacks by extremists. The Bureau also encouraged the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µ to find mechanisms to increase the protection of the Palestinian population. The Bureau emphasized the need to focus the attention of the international community on the question of Palestine and re-launch a credible negotiating process culminating in the two-State solution. The Chair also thanked the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µ for complying swiftly with the General Assembly resolution requesting an advisory opinion from the International Court of Justice. The need to provide adequate and predictable funding to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µRWA was also raised. The Secretary-General reiterated the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µ support for the two-State solution and looked forward to visit the OPT in the near future.
